The Eye in the Sky: Advanced Surveillance

The most noticeable element of casino security is the massive network of cameras.

Comprehensive Coverage: Contemporary casinos have hundreds of high-definition cameras that cover nearly every square inch of the property, casino from gaming tables to cash cages and even hallways. Behavioral Analytics: Advanced AI can analyze video feeds to identify unusual behavior patterns that might signal cheating or an intention to commit a crim Facial Recognition Technology: Many establishments now use facial recognition software that can immediately scan faces and compare them against databases of known cheaters, advantage players, and barred individuals.

Recognizing the Symptoms of Compulsive Gambling

It's also crucial to be honest and recognize the warning signs of problem gambling, either in yourself or in someone you know. If these signs sound like you, it is essential to seek help. Organizations like GamCare, Gamblers Anonymous, and BeGambleAware offer free, confidential support and advic
